APP下载

利用PLC控制步进电动机的启动与停止

2015-02-03杨胜利

中小企业管理与科技·中旬刊 2014年10期
关键词:程序

杨胜利

摘要:在一些小型设备和设计精度不高的设备中常常会用到步进电动机,如何让步进电动机启动和停止,是需要我们解决的问题,可以通过不同种方式完成对电机的控制。

关键词:步进电动机  PLC  步进驱动器  程序

2013年山东省高级技师实训操作试题一:运料小车由步进电动机控制。这说明步进电动机在一些控制精度不高的设备中已经得到广泛应用。例如:线切割、简易自动生产线设备都使用步进电动机来完成设备的直线运动。

步进电动机是如何能够旋转的,步进电机是一种将电脉冲信号转化为角位移的执行机构,一般电动机都是连续旋转的,而步进电机的转动是一步一步进行的,每输入一个脉冲电信号,步进电机就转动一个角度,通过改变脉冲频率和数量,可实现步进电机的调速和控制转动的角位移大小,具有较高的定位精度,其最小步距角可达0.75,转动、停止、反转反应灵敏可靠。而步距角是每输入一个电脉冲信号时转子转过的角度称为步距角,步距角的大小可直接影响电机的运行精度。

步进电机的运行要有一电子装置进行驱动,这种装置就是步进电机驱动器,它是把控制系统发出的脉冲信号,加以放大以驱动步进电机。步进电机的转速与脉冲信号的频率成正比,控制步进电机脉冲信号的频率,可以对电机精确调速;控制步进脉冲的个数,可以对电机精确定位。整步:最基本的驱动方式,这种驱动方式的每个脉冲使电机移动一个基本步矩角。例如:标准两相电机的一圈共有200个步矩角,则整步驱动方式下,每个脉冲可以使电机移动1.8°,而半步是在单相激磁时,电机转轴停至整步位置上,驱动器收到下一个脉冲后,如给另一相激磁且保持原来相继续处在激磁状态,则电机转轴将移动半个基本步矩角,停在相邻两个整步位置的中间。如此循环地对两相线圈进行单相然后两相激磁,步进电机将以每个脉冲半个基本步矩角的方式转动。步进电机的相数是指电机内部的线圈组数,目前常用的有二相、三相、四相、五相步进电机。电机相数不同,其步距角也不同,一般二相电机的步距角为0.9°至1.8°、三相的为0.75°至1.5°、五相的为0.36°至0.72°。在没有细分驱动器时,用户主要靠选择不同相数的步进电机来满足自己步距角的要求。如果使用细分驱动器,则相数将变得没有意义,用户只需在驱动器上改变细分设置数就可以改变步距角。步进电机的拍数指的是电机转过一个齿距角所需的脉冲数。

①细分:细分就是指电机运行时的实际步矩角是基本步矩角的几分之一。如:驱动器工作在10细分状态时,其步矩角只为电机固有步矩角的十分之一,也就是说:当驱动器工作在不细分的整步状态时,控制系统每发一个步进脉冲,电机转动1.8°,而用细分驱动器工作在10细分状态时,电机只转动了0.18。细分功能完全是由驱动器靠精度控制电机的相电流所产生的,与电机无关。细分是控制精度的标志,通过增大细分能改善精度。步进电机都有低频振荡的特点,如果电机需要工作在低频共振区,细分驱动器是很好的选择。此外,细分和不细分相比,输出转矩对各种电机都有不同程度的提升。②硬件准备。S7-200 PLC、步进驱动器KINCO9(步科)3M458、步进电机3S57Q-

04056和连线。电机的连线:由于步进电机是三相步进电动机需要把电机接成三角形。整步方式下步距角是1.8°,半步方式下步距角为0.9°,相电流为5.8A。③步进驱动器接线及接点的解释:PLS+和PLS-为脉冲信号的接点:脉冲信号的数量、频率与步进电机的位移和速度成正比;DIR+和DIR-为方向信号的接点:它的高低电平决定电动机的旋转方向;FREE+和FREE-为脱机信号:当为ON时,驱动器将断开输入到步进电动机的电源回路;当为OFF时,步进电动机在上电后,即使静止时也保持自动半流的锁紧状态。步进驱动器主要解决的问题是:脉冲的分配和功率放大。脉冲分配(环形脉冲分配器):用来控制步进电动机的通电运行方式,其作用是把控制器送来的一串指令脉冲按照一定的顺序和分配方式控制各相绕组的通断,由于步进电动机的工作原理是各绕组必须按一定的顺序通电变化才能正常工作,完成这种通电顺序变化的规律我们称为环形分配器。驱动器采用的是细分驱动电源:这里的细分表示为每送给步进电动机一相或几相绕组一个脉冲信号的电压,步进电动机就旋转一步即步距角,如果在一拍中通电相的电流不是一次直接到达最大值,而是分成多次,每次增加都会使转子转动一小步;同样的绕组电流的下降也是分成几次完成,这样的方式称为细分,这样步进电机由原来的一步到达便分成许多微步来完成实现了步进的细分。在实际应用中,步进驱动器的侧面有一个红色的8位开关我们称为功能设定开关,主要用来设定驱动器的工作方式和工作参数。其中开关1至3用来表示细分设置用,如果开关打在ON,表示使用,如果打在OFF表示此开关不用,加细分设置表。

DIP4:ON表示静态电流全流,OFF表示静态电流半流。

DIP5至DIP8:表示输出相电流设置用,加输出相电流的设置表。

电路的整体接线图(图1)。

步进电机的控制方式:

①利用字节控制步进电机。在主程序中调用初始化子程序,在子程序中设置:

a设置PTO/PWM控制字节(Q0.0对应的是字节SMB67;Q0.1对应的是字节SMB77)。b写入周期值:(Q0.0对应的是字节SMW68;Q0.1对应的是字节SMW78)。c写入脉冲串计数值:(Q0.0对应的是字节SMD72;Q0.1对应的是字节SMD82)。d连接中断事件和中断服务程序,允许中断(可选)。e执行PLS指令,使S7-200CPU对PTO硬件编程。(图2)

图2                      图3

②利用包络控制步进电机(图3)。

③利用库控制步进电机(图4)。

Velocity_ss:启动/停止频率(最低速度),单位:pulse/Second

Velocity_max:最大频率(最高速度),单位:pulse/Second。

Accel_dec_time:加减速时间 Fwd_limit:正向限位开关

Rev_limit:反向限位开关  C_pos:当前的脉冲数值

Num_pulses:脉冲数值(必须大于1)

velocity:预设的频率(预设的速度)direcition:预设的方向(0表示反向,1表示正向)。

Done:完成位

步进电动机最大的优势在于它控制简单,投资成本低,所以很多小型设备在设计上优先选择步进电机,而步进电动机的型号非常全。但是其缺点是其控制精度不高,在一些高精尖的设备已不再采用,而是用交流伺服电机来驱动。

参考文献:

[1]李全.PLC运动控制技术应用设计与实践[M].机械工业出版社.

[2]陈伯时.电力拖动自动控制系统[M].机械工业出版社.

[3]张明.步进电机的基本原理[J].科技信息,2007(09).

猜你喜欢

程序
试论我国未决羁押程序的立法完善
失能的信仰——走向衰亡的民事诉讼程序
“程序猿”的生活什么样
英国与欧盟正式启动“离婚”程序程序
创卫暗访程序有待改进
恐怖犯罪刑事诉讼程序的完善